Assessment of the frequency and association with morbidity of DNA markers in multinational administrative divisions based on indigenous population data (based on cardiovascular diseases)
Information on morbidity is presented in statistical reports for the entire population of multinational subjects of Russia, but population Biobanks contain information on individual peoples.Aim.
